Functional Principle and Characteristics

The eco nozzle technology is based on a multi-stage venturi principle. Schmalz has refined this technology to make vacuum generation with compressed air more efficient, thus offering an ideal combination of suction capacity and energy efficiency. Core of the entire product line is the ejector module ecoPump. The ecoPump is available in two characteristics, depending on the application area. They provide an almost identical suction capacity, but differ in terms of the maximum achievable vacuum.

High Vacuum (HV) for airtight applications

  • Use in applications where a high vacuum can be reached
  • Ideal for airtight workpieces

High Flow (HF) for porous applications

  • Use in applications where a high vacuum cannot be reached
  • Reaches the same suction rate as the HV version with a lower compressed air consumption
  • Saves energy when handling porous workpieces

Compact Ejectors and Terminals

Centralized vacuum generators with integrated additional functions

The compact ejectors are available in various designs. The SCPSb is suitable for handling air-tight and slightly porous workpieces and is equipped with vacuum and blow-off control valves. The SCPS/SCPSi have other additional features: Air-saving function, automatic blow-off and communication via IO-Link (type SCPSi). The SCTSi compact terminal can be operated with universal component grippers. It can connect up to 16 ejectors, has a central energy supply and an IO-Link connection via the control module.

Added Value for Your Processes: Additional Functions of Schmalz Compact Ejectors

IO-Link interface

  • Bidirectional communication with all current field-bus systems
  • Recorded condition data can be viewed and used up to control level
  • Supports remote parameterization and remote diagnostics

Automatic air saving function

  • 80 % reduction of compressed air consumption by switching off the suction function when not needed
  • No electrical signals required
